Mojo Criollo Marinade

A bright, citrusy, smoky marinade for chicken, pork, veal and seafood. Makes enough for 1-2 pounds of meat.

Ingredients
- ⅓ cup lime juice fresh squeezed
- ⅓ cup lemon juice fresh squeezed
- ⅓ cup tangerine juice fresh squeezed
- ¼ cup olive oil
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
- 1 ½ teaspoons dried Greek oregano
- 2 teaspoons ground cumin
- 6 large cloves garlic minced
- ½ cup fresh chopped cilantro roughly chopped
- ½ habanero pepper or serrano seeded, finely minced (can also use 1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es)
Instructions
TO MAKE IN THE FOOD PROCESSOR:
- Combine all the ingredients except habanero pepper into mini food processor.
- Pulse several times until ingredients are chopped well and combined. Transfer the sauce to a bowl or storage container. Add the hot pepper and stir. Refrigerate until ready to use for marinade.
TO ASSEMBLE IN A BOWL.
- Combine all ingredients in a bowl and whisk to combine. Pour over chicken, pork chops, veal or seafood and marinate for 1-2 hours. For larger pieces of meat, marinate for 4-6 hours to more fully penetrate.
MAKE AHEAD:
- Can be made up to two days in advance. Use as a marinade for chicken, pork, veal and seafood or as a sauce to drizzle over grilled proteins.
Notes
- You can make the marinade a day or two in advance.
